My problem is, that everyone has stated that osCommerce will automatically throw your site into secure mode when you go to account or checkout. This has not happened for me. I have SSL turned on, but have not purchased any security certs. I have SSL turned on, but have not purchased any security certs. Thanks for the advanced help You'll have to get an SSL Certificate or find out if your host has a shared certificate. Also, remember that there are two configure.php files (catalog/includes and catalog/admin/includes).

♥Vger Posted December 31, 2004 Posted December 31, 2004 You may have access to a shared ssl from your hosting company, but you are not using it. The reason you are getting the security alert is because in the file you posted you have ENABLE_SSL set to 'true', and you have given an https address for a website with a full ssl certificate installed - when you have no ssl at all.
